There was a young man with a salary,
Who had to do drawings for Malory;
When they asked him for more,
He replied, 'Why? Sure
You've enough as it is for a gallery.'
Aubrey Beardsley

What view the bill-sticker and sandwich man take of the subject I have yet to learn. The first is, at least, no bad substitute for a hanging committee, and the clothes of the second are better company than somebody else's picture, and less obtrusive than a background of stamped magenta paper.
Aubrey Beardsley

It takes only one man to make an artist, but forty to make an Academician.
Aubrey Beardsley
